BAKU, Azerbaijan, July 15. Azerbaijan’s foreign
trade turnover totaled $24.661 billion in January-June 2026,
Trend’s calculations
based on data from the State Customs Committee of Azerbaijan
show.
According to the committee, the figure increased by $261
million, or 1.1%, compared with the same period last year.
Exports accounted for $16.32 billion of the total foreign trade
turnover, while imports amounted to $8.341 billion.
The committee said export volumes increased by $3.442 billion,
or 26.7%, in January-June, while imports decreased by $3.181
billion, or 27.6%.
As a result, Azerbaijan recorded a positive foreign trade
balance of $7.979 billion. According to Trend’s calculations, this
is 5.9 times higher, or $6.623 billion more, than the figure
recorded in the same period last year.
